Job Description:
• Provide consecutive interpretation services between English and Spanish across various industries (medical, legal, customer service, etc.)
• Ensure complete accuracy, clarity, and neutrality in interpretation—preserving tone, intent, and emotion
• Maintain confidentiality and impartiality at all times
• Manage call flow professionally, including respectfully intervening when clarification is needed
• Demonstrate emotional intelligence, especially in high-pressure or emotionally charged interactions
• Apply short term memory retention, active listening, and note taking techniques to manage longer exchanges
• Remain strictly within the interpreter’s role without offering personal opinions or advice
• Participate in ongoing training, coaching, and feedback sessions to maintain and enhance performance
• Utilize basic computer tools (MS Office, internal platforms) to effectively manage calls and log activity
